Gentoo Archives: gentoo-commits

From: Mikle Kolyada <zlogene@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: xfce-extra/xfce4-screensaver/
Date: Tue, 06 Oct 2020 18:30:44
Message-Id: 1602009013.64e9924d5f7ec817f77882b77f4eb3797f904b36.zlogene@gentoo
1 commit: 64e9924d5f7ec817f77882b77f4eb3797f904b36
2 Author: Mikle Kolyada <zlogene <AT> gentoo <DOT> org>
3 AuthorDate: Tue Oct 6 18:30:13 2020 +0000
4 Commit: Mikle Kolyada <zlogene <AT> gentoo <DOT> org>
5 CommitDate: Tue Oct 6 18:30:13 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=64e9924d
7
8 xfce-extra/xfce4-screensaver: remove consolekit support
9
10 Package-Manager: Portage-3.0.4, Repoman-3.0.1
11 Signed-off-by: Mikle Kolyada <zlogene <AT> gentoo.org>
12
13 xfce-extra/xfce4-screensaver/metadata.xml | 1 -
14 xfce-extra/xfce4-screensaver/xfce4-screensaver-0.1.10.ebuild | 5 ++---
15 2 files changed, 2 insertions(+), 4 deletions(-)
16
17 diff --git a/xfce-extra/xfce4-screensaver/metadata.xml b/xfce-extra/xfce4-screensaver/metadata.xml
18 index bc30ef33465..43b2b067558 100644
19 --- a/xfce-extra/xfce4-screensaver/metadata.xml
20 +++ b/xfce-extra/xfce4-screensaver/metadata.xml
21 @@ -5,7 +5,6 @@
22 <email>xfce@g.o</email>
23 </maintainer>
24 <use>
25 - <flag name='consolekit'>Enable ConsoleKit support</flag>
26 <flag name='locking'>Enable screen locking support</flag>
27 </use>
28 </pkgmetadata>
29
30 diff --git a/xfce-extra/xfce4-screensaver/xfce4-screensaver-0.1.10.ebuild b/xfce-extra/xfce4-screensaver/xfce4-screensaver-0.1.10.ebuild
31 index e06a050f578..da385e71b5c 100644
32 --- a/xfce-extra/xfce4-screensaver/xfce4-screensaver-0.1.10.ebuild
33 +++ b/xfce-extra/xfce4-screensaver/xfce4-screensaver-0.1.10.ebuild
34 @@ -10,7 +10,7 @@ SRC_URI="https://archive.xfce.org/src/apps/${PN}/${PV%.*}/${P}.tar.bz2"
35 LICENSE="GPL-2+ LGPL-2+"
36 SLOT="0"
37 KEYWORDS="~alpha amd64 ~arm64 ~ppc ~ppc64 x86"
38 -IUSE="consolekit elogind +locking opengl pam systemd"
39 +IUSE="elogind +locking opengl pam systemd"
40
41 # Xrandr: optional but automagic
42 RDEPEND="
43 @@ -29,7 +29,6 @@ RDEPEND="
44 >=xfce-base/libxfce4ui-4.12.1:=
45 >=xfce-base/libxfce4util-4.12.1:=
46 >=xfce-base/xfconf-4.12.1:=
47 - consolekit? ( sys-auth/consolekit )
48 elogind? ( sys-auth/elogind )
49 locking? (
50 pam? ( sys-libs/pam )
51 @@ -51,11 +50,11 @@ src_configure() {
52 # xscreensaver dirs autodetection doesn't seem to work
53 --with-xscreensaverdir=/usr/share/xscreensaver/config
54 --with-xscreensaverhackdir=/usr/$(get_libdir)/misc/xscreensaver
55 + --without-console-kit
56
57 $(use_with opengl libgl)
58 $(use_enable locking)
59 $(use_enable pam)
60 - $(use_with consolekit console-kit)
61 $(use_with elogind)
62 $(use_with systemd)
63 )